Goji Juicery and Kitchen appears in inspection records six times, starting in 2023. Inspectors last stopped by on Jan 27, 2026. Medium risk typically reflects a handful of issues that inspectors wrote up but didn't deem critical.

Violation counts have ticked up lately, averaging around four violations per visit versus roughly one violation earlier in the record.

When inspectors have written things up, “no proof provided that food employees are informed” has been the most frequent reason, cited two times.

Compared to the broader North Miami Beach restaurant scene, this is about average. On the whole, the file is mixed but not concerning.
